Activities - how the charity spends its money
The Thomas Brereton Charity (no 216947). It was created in 1711 to help the poor in the village by handing out coal and potatoes. The charity has trustees that are members of Ashley Parish Council. The Parish Councillors each give £10. A discussion at one of the public Council meetings is held to decide on one villager that has had a difficult year. The £80 buys a food hamper for them.
